Product Description:
The Danfoss 178B4820 Frequency Converter operates effectively across a wide supply frequency range and ensures high torque delivery at various operating conditions. The converter supports multiple input types, torque levels and switching parameters.
This 178B4820 frequency converter is designed to work within a supply frequency range of 48 to 62 Hz with a tolerance of ± 1 %. It includes a high maximum short circuit rating of 100,000 A which supports safe operation under fault conditions. The converter permits approximately one switching operation every two minutes on supply inputs L1, L2 and L3. It delivers starting torque of 180 % for a short burst of 0.5 seconds that is ideal for demanding motor starts. The acceleration torque is rated at 100 % and arresting torque at 0 rpm in closed loop operation is also 100 % that enables controlled stopping and holding. The analog control section of the model includes two programmable voltage/thermistor inputs located at terminals 53 and 54. These inputs accept voltage levels from 0 to ±10 V DC and offer a scalable interface with an input resistance of 10 kΩ. It features one programmable analog current input on terminal 60 that supports a scalable range of 4 to ± 20 mA. These capabilities allow flexible integration with various sensor and control devices for precise process management.
The external 24 Volt DC supply interface on this 178B4820 frequency converter is located at terminals 35 and 36. It supports a voltage range of 24 V DC ± 15 % with a temporary peak of up to 37 V DC for 10 seconds. The unit allows a maximum voltage ripple of 2 V DC and consumes between 15 W and 50 W of power with peak startup power reaching 50 W for 20 milliseconds.
